CMCL 503 - Contours of Contemporary Culture - Winter 2018

A critical and inter-disciplinary examination, via classic texts, of how modernity has been transformed within the framework of an evolving global culture. Focus will be on the major ideas, principles, and their implications within the time-frame of the middle twentieth to early twenty-first centuries.
This course may not be repeated for credit.
